The Bach Society of Minnesota’s 2025 Minnesota Bach Festival takes place February 28-March 30 with a month of vibrant and rich musical offerings. Highlights include the Mozart Requiem concert and Community Sing-along, a weekend of Mobile Mini-Concerts, Bach’s birthday concert, a Masterclass on Bach’s keyboard music, a celebration of the 300th anniversary of the Anna Magdalena Bach Notebooks with a lecture and recital, the Bach & Friends musical workshop, and the collaborative performance of Baroque Tango: Rhythms of Desire, Longing, and Passion.
